Abstract

The invention relates to a polymicrobial detection device using quantum dot nanocrystal complexes and a detection method therefor.  One aspect of the invention provides a nanocrystal-microbial attractant complex, for which a microbial attractant for attracting microbes is coupled to a nanocrystal containing one or more element selected from a metal group consisting of zinc, cadmium, lead, copper, gallium, arsenic, thallium, nickel, manganese and bismuth, and a preparation method therefor.  Further, the invention provides a polymicrobial detection method based on the electrochemical analysis that involves the use of a detection kit for detecting microbes using said nanocrystal-microbial attractant complex, and the SWASV (Square wave anode stripping voltammetric) method using said detection kit.
